The Role of Encryption in Securing Data in Cloud Storage

In the digital age, cloud storage has become an indispensable tool for businesses and individuals to store, access, and share data. However, with its convenience comes a significant concern: data security. Encryption is a key technology that ensures sensitive information remains protected in cloud environments. This article explores how encryption safeguards cloud-stored data, its types, challenges, and best practices.


Understanding Cloud Storage and Its Risks

Cloud storage allows users to store data on remote servers accessible via the internet. While this eliminates the need for physical storage and provides scalability, it also exposes data to risks such as:

  1. Unauthorized Access – Hackers can exploit vulnerabilities to gain access to sensitive information.
  2. Data Breaches – Compromised cloud accounts can lead to large-scale data exposure.
  3. Man-in-the-Middle (MITM) Attacks – Interception of data during transmission can compromise its integrity.

Encryption acts as a robust defense mechanism against these risks.


What Is Encryption?

Encryption converts plain, readable data into a coded format (ciphertext) that can only be deciphered with a unique decryption key. It ensures that even if unauthorized parties access the data, they cannot understand or misuse it without the decryption key.


Types of Encryption Used in Cloud Storage

  1. Symmetric Encryption

    • Uses a single key for both encryption and decryption.
    • Example: Advanced Encryption Standard (AES).
    • Pros: Faster and efficient for large data volumes.
    • Cons: Key management is critical—compromising the key risks the data.
  2. Asymmetric Encryption

    • Employs a pair of keys: a public key for encryption and a private key for decryption.
    • Example: RSA (Rivest-Shamir-Adleman).
    • Pros: More secure key sharing.
    • Cons: Slower compared to symmetric encryption.
  3. End-to-End Encryption (E2EE)

    • Encrypts data at the source and only decrypts it at the recipient’s end.
    • Ideal for: Messaging apps and file-sharing services.
  4. Homomorphic Encryption

    • Allows computations on encrypted data without decrypting it.
    • Use case: Privacy-preserving cloud data analysis.

How Encryption Secures Cloud Data

  1. Data-at-Rest Encryption

    • Protects stored data on cloud servers.
    • Prevents unauthorized access even if physical storage devices are compromised.
  2. Data-in-Transit Encryption

    • Secures data as it moves between devices and cloud servers using protocols like TLS (Transport Layer Security).
    • Shields against MITM attacks.
  3. End-User Device Encryption

    • Ensures that data saved locally on user devices is encrypted before uploading to the cloud.
  4. Zero-Knowledge Encryption

    • The cloud provider has no access to encryption keys, ensuring maximum privacy.

Challenges of Implementing Encryption in Cloud Storage

  1. Key Management

    • Storing and distributing encryption keys securely is complex. Mismanagement can lead to data loss or exposure.
  2. Performance Trade-Offs

    • Encryption and decryption processes consume computational resources, potentially slowing operations.
  3. Regulatory Compliance

    • Different countries have varying encryption standards and data protection regulations, complicating global operations.
  4. Cost

    • Implementing robust encryption systems, especially advanced types like homomorphic encryption, can be expensive.

Best Practices for Encryption in Cloud Storage

  1. Use Strong Encryption Protocols

    • Adopt industry-standard algorithms like AES-256 for robust protection.
  2. Implement Multi-Factor Authentication (MFA)

    • Combine encryption with MFA to enhance security.
  3. Regularly Update Encryption Keys

    • Rotate keys periodically to minimize risks from compromised keys.
  4. Adopt a Zero-Trust Model

    • Verify every access request to encrypted data, regardless of its origin.
  5. Encrypt Backups

    • Ensure that backup copies stored in the cloud are encrypted to prevent unauthorized access.

The Future of Encryption in Cloud Security

As cyber threats evolve, encryption technologies must adapt. Emerging advancements include:

  • Quantum-Resistant Encryption – Algorithms designed to withstand attacks from quantum computers.
  • AI-Powered Encryption – Using artificial intelligence to optimize encryption processes and detect anomalies.
  • Privacy-Preserving Computing – Innovations like secure multi-party computation to enhance collaborative security.

Conclusion

Encryption is the cornerstone of secure data management in cloud storage systems. By protecting data at rest, in transit, and during processing, encryption ensures confidentiality and integrity, even in the face of growing cyber threats. While challenges like key management and performance remain, advancements in encryption technologies promise a more secure future for cloud storage.

For businesses and individuals relying on the cloud, adopting robust encryption practices is not just a security measure—it’s a necessity for safeguarding trust and privacy in the digital world.

Comments

Popular posts from this blog